1. AI-powered obstacle avoidance
A robot with AI can detect obstacles automatically and adjust its movements to avoid them. It makes use of sensors and cameras to detect objects. Advanced algorithms are employed to determine the best way to move. It also learns from its environment and adapt its behavior over time.
Cleaning robots are an increasingly popular device for the consumer market. They can complete a range of tasks, such as mopping, vacuuming, and even window cleaning. Some models can even be employed as a personal assistant to program activities and control smart home appliances, and provide weather updates. They may be hindered by obstacles that stop them from functioning. This can be caused either by debris or dust getting caught in the nozzle, or by objects becoming entangled in brush. Many robot cleaners come with AI-powered technology to avoid these issues.
The most commonly used types of obstacle avoidance technology in robots include ultrasonic light, and camera sensors. Ultrasonic sensors emit high-frequency sound waves that can detect obstacles and other items in rooms. They can also be used to detect changes in height, such as the edges of carpets or stairs. Some DEEBOT robots employ this sensor to boost suction power when navigating staircases and other areas that are difficult to navigate.
Other robots use a sophisticated obstacle avoidance technique known as simultaneous mapping and localization (SLAM). These robots utilize laser sensors to make an accurate map of their surroundings. They also can recognize specific characteristics of obstacles, like their size and shape. SLAM technology is commonly used by robot vacuum black friday vacuums to navigate around furniture and other large obstacles.
In addition to being able to detect obstacles, AI-powered cleaning robots can also make decisions and act based on the data they get from their sensors. This process is known as machine learning and involves the use of computer algorithms to learn from and make predictions about data. This information can be used to improve robot's performance and efficiency. When an AI-powered robot has identified an object, it can send control commands to its actuators like motors or servos that allow it to move around that object.

4. Scheduled cleaning
Many robot vacuum deals black friday cleaners can be capable of vacuuming and mopping multiple times per week to remove food crumbs, and pet hair. Owners say that their homes are much cleaner and smell fresher. This frequency can wear down sensors, brushes and batteries more quickly. To extend the life of your robot follow the instructions of the manufacturer for charging and emptying. Wipe sensors and rolls clean as needed, and keep a can of compressed air on hand to blow away dust from gears and the hard-to-reach nooks within the base. Replace filters, side brushes and brush rolls in accordance with the instructions.
Whether you have one robot or a combination of models, all can connect to your home Wi-Fi and be programmed using the smartphone app, voice control using Alexa or Google Assistant, or by using the manual buttons on the unit itself. This connection lets you observe the progress of cleaning in real time.
If you've zoned and mapped your floor space, you can decide which rooms are included in the scheduled clean, and alter the settings to suit your needs - from mop intensity and water flow rate to vacuum power mode. You can also set up "no-go" zones to prevent the machine from going through certain areas, such as hallways.
The majority of smart robots are able to be programmed to clean according to specific health and safety guidelines. It is recommended to schedule surfaces that are often touched to be cleaned every day in the event of an outbreak, or to clean them immediately after contact with blood or other potentially dangerous substances.
Like all electrical appliances it is important to make sure that your robot is wired into a flat surface to prevent falls. You should also think about the best place for your robot as it will affect how it moves around the room and its navigation accuracy. Ideally, the unit should be placed approximately 2 feet away from any objects on either side, and four feet away from furniture (including tables and chairs) and stairs. This will allow the robot to find a clear path without obstacles and ensure a more precise cleaning.
